Career path
| Career Role | Description |
|---|---|
| Urban Planner (Humanitarian Focus) | Develops and implements sustainable urban planning strategies in crisis-affected areas, focusing on community needs and resilience. High demand for expertise in disaster risk reduction. |
| Emergency Response Coordinator (Urban Settings) | Manages and coordinates emergency response teams within densely populated urban environments. Requires strong leadership, logistics, and communication skills; critical for humanitarian aid delivery. |
| Shelter and Settlements Specialist (Urban Focus) | Provides expertise in the design, construction, and management of emergency shelters and settlements in urban areas. Experience in sustainable materials and community participation is highly valued. |
| Urban Resilience Consultant | Advises organizations on building urban resilience to future shocks and stresses. Key skills include risk assessment, capacity building, and stakeholder engagement; in high demand in the UK's urban planning sector. |
